Our Practice Areas

Our practice areas include:

  • Probate: We assist clients in navigating the complex probate process in Texas, helping them to determine whether probate is necessary and guiding them through the steps required to settle an estate.
  • Estate Planning: We help clients create a comprehensive estate plan, including wills, trusts, and powers of attorney, to ensure that their wishes are carried out after they are gone.
  • Eviction: We represent landlords and tenants in eviction proceedings, working to resolve disputes and ensure that properties are managed effectively.
